Understanding the Regulatory Landscape
Navigating the regulatory landscape in the United States is essential for any bank operating within its borders, and n0oscworldsc is no exception. The US banking system is governed by a complex web of federal and state regulations designed to ensure the stability of the financial system, protect consumers, and prevent financial crimes. The primary federal regulators include the Federal Reserve System (the Fed), the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C), the Office of the Comptroller of the Currency (OCC), and the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B). The Federal Reserve plays a key role in supervising banks, setting monetary policy, and maintaining the stability of the financial system. The FDIC insures deposits at banks, protecting depositors in the event of bank failure. The OCC charters, regulates, and supervises national banks and federal savings associations. The CFPB is responsible for protecting consumers by enforcing federal consumer financial laws. In addition to these federal regulators, banks also must comply with state-level regulations. Each state has its own banking regulations, which can vary widely. n0oscworldsc must adhere to the rules in the states where they have a presence. Compliance with these regulations is not only a legal requirement but also a critical factor in maintaining the bank's reputation and building trust with its customers. Strict adherence to regulations helps to minimize financial risks, prevent fraud, and ensure the safety and soundness of the financial system.
Key Regulatory Bodies and Laws
Let’s dive a bit deeper into the key regulatory bodies and laws that shape the operations of n0oscworldsc in the US. The Dodd-Frank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ection Act is a landmark piece of legislation enacted in response to the 2008 financial crisis. This act introduced sweeping reforms to the financial system, including increased regulation of banks, enhanced consumer protections, and new oversight authorities. The Bank Secrecy Act (BSA) and the USA PATRIOT Act are designed to prevent money laundering and terrorist financing. These laws require banks to implement robust anti-money laundering (AML) programs, including customer due diligence, suspicious activity reporting, and transaction monitoring. The Community Reinvestment Act (CRA) is designed to encourage banks to meet the credit needs of the communities in which they operate, particularly low- and moderate-income neighborhoods. This act requires banks to demonstrate their commitment to serving their communities through lending, investment, and service activities. The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act (FATCA) is aimed at preventing tax evasion by US taxpayers who hold financial assets in foreign accounts. This law requires foreign financial institutions, including n0oscworldsc, to report information on US account holders to the IRS. Understanding these regulations is critical for n0oscworldsc.
